Public bug reported: Test Case: 1. Start gnome-software and close it 2. Make sure gnome-software is still running in the background $ pgrep -l gnome-software 3. Restart snapd $ sudo service snapd restart 4. Open gnome-software 5. Click on 'Search' 6. Search 'gedit'
